package com.chiorichan.factory.event;

import java.util.Arrays;
import java.util.List;

import org.apache.commons.lang3.StringUtils;

import com.chiorichan.event.EventHandler;
import com.chiorichan.event.Listener;
import com.google.common.collect.Lists;
import com.google.javascript.jscomp.CompilationLevel;
import com.google.javascript.jscomp.Compiler;
import com.google.javascript.jscomp.CompilerOptions;
import com.google.javascript.jscomp.SourceFile;

public class PostJSMinProcessor implements Listener {
    @EventHandler()
    public void onEvent(PostEvalEvent event) {
        if (!event.context().contentType().equals("application/javascript-x")
                || !event.context().filename().endsWith("js"))
            return;

        // A simple way to ignore JS files that might already be minimized
        if (event.context().filename() != null && event.context().filename().toLowerCase().endsWith(".min.js"))
            return;

        String code = event.context().readString();
        List<SourceFile> externs = Lists.newArrayList();
        List<SourceFile> inputs = Arrays.asList(SourceFile.fromCode(
                (event.context().filename() == null || event.context().filename().isEmpty()) ? "fakefile.js"
                        : event.context().filename(),
                code));

        Compiler compiler = new Compiler();

        CompilerOptions options = new CompilerOptions();

        CompilationLevel.SIMPLE_OPTIMIZATIONS.setOptionsForCompilationLevel(options);

        compiler.compile(externs, inputs, options);

        event.context().resetAndWrite(StringUtils.trimToNull(compiler.toSource()));
    }

}
